
Extended stay hotels look just the same as the room you'd book for a few days or a week. How much is it to stay at extended-stay for a month? If you are going with a budget extended-stay you can get your cost down to around $1,600 for a month but if you are going with a more premium hotel chain, expect to be closer to $2,800+ a month.

How much do extended stay hotels pay?
How much does Extended Stay Hotels in the United States pay? The average Extended Stay Hotels salary ranges from approximately $21,982 per year for Housekeeper to $152,693 per year for Senior Corporate Counsel. Average Extended Stay Hotels hourly pay ranges from approximately $8.87 per hour for Desk Clerk to $18.12 per hour for Maintenance Manager.
Do hotels give discounts for extended stays?
Some hotel chains cater to week or longer stays. Extended Stay America, a chain with more than 700 locations in the United States, offers discounts for weekly stays and even greater discounts for stays of a month or longer. Each Extended Stay America suite has its own equipped kitchen and a work area.
Are extended stay hotels cheaper?
Extended stay hotels appeal to guests because rooms tend to be cheaper than full-service, and even some limited-service, hotels. Rates start at less than $50 a night for a roughly 300-square-foot room, with a kitchenette that usually includes a stovetop ...

How long can you stay in a extended stay hotel?
How long can you stay in an extended stay hotel? You can stay as long as the property allows, though rates may fluctuate over time. Although these hotels can hypothetically host guests for a night or two, most see guests who stay for five to seven days at a minimum since that's when discounts are typically applied.
How much would it be a month to live in a hotel?
Personally, I found that monthly hotel rentals average around $800 a month and up — but it depends on the hotel you choose and where it's located: The cheapest weekly rate hotels range from $90 to $125 a week — but they aren't always in the safest neighborhoods and they don't include any amenities.

Is living in a hotel cheaper than renting?
Cost to Live in a Hotel The short answer: living in a hotel is as expensive as you make it. It can be less expensive or more expensive than renting an apartment, depending on your standard of living and how you are able to deduct expenses.

Can a person live in a hotel permanently?
Can you live in a hotel permanently? You can live in some hotels indefinitely and for long periods of time which is essentially a permanent residence in some cases. As long as the hotel does not have restrictions on the duration of your stay, you should be able to remain there as long as you wish as a paying guest.

How long will my noisy neighbor stay in my hotel?
In a longer-stay hotel, your noisy neighbor will probably be there for more than a few days. While you can ask the front desk for a hint of the neighbor’s departure date, due to privacy rules, they may not be able to share that, so it’s probably best to suck it up, pack your things, and move.

Do hotels have safes?
Many longer-stay hotel rooms don’t contain safes. If you’re nervous about keeping your valuables safe, be sure your luggage locks and you can use your luggage as a safe. Even if an in-room safe is included, it’s unlikely it will be large enough to hold your computer, and placing it in your locked luggage will take care of this concern.
Do extended stay hotels have 4 seasons?
Extended-stay hotels aren’t the Four Seasons and generally don’t pretend to be. If you’re lucky, the housekeeper might come by weekly or, as in my case, bi-weekly. The hotel might offer a paid upgrade to receive weekly housekeeping or linen exchange.
Can hotel towels grate on you?
My recommendation is that you stop at the store to pick up a larger one (or two) or bring one from home. The towels provided by the hotel might be fine for a night or two but can literally grate on you after a week.
